Dave Grohl Remembers Excitement of Soundgarden's Superunknown
. One of those people was then-Nirvana drummer Dave Grohl, who spoke about the album and "Black Hole Sun" in a video that was posted to Soundgarden's official YouTube page. Grohl says his first reaction to the album was, "Holy s-t! This is gonna be huge! It was the perfect meeting of the Beatles And Black Sabbath. Which is what I think we put in our Nirvana bio: We sound like ABBA and Black Sabbath, or [like] the Beatles and Black Sabbath. But I don't think that that had ever successfully been paired until that record and, in particular, that song." In 2004, Grohl collaborated with Soundgarden's guitarist Kim Thayil on the Probot project, which had Grohl producing tracks for various legendary metal vocalists (Thayil played guitar on two tracks). Most recently, Grohl directed the video for Soundgarden's "By Crooked Steps," from their latest album 2012′s King Animal. Check out the video.
